Diferència entre Varchar i Nvarchar

Autora: Laura McKinney
Data De La Creació: 2 Abril 2021
Data D’Actualització: 16 Ser Possible 2024
Anonim
Diferència entre Varchar i Nvarchar - Estil De Vida
Diferència entre Varchar i Nvarchar - Estil De Vida

Content

Diferència principal

Varchar i nvarchar són informació de varietats en SQL Server. El predominant entre varchar i narchar és que el narchar s’utilitza per emmagatzemar caràcters Unicode mentre que varchar s’utilitza per emmagatzemar caràcters no Unicode. L’emmagatzematge de dades és d’1 byte per caràcter a varchar mentre que l’emmagatzematge d’informació a nvarchar és de 2 bytes per caràcter. En definició de temes, varchar ajuda fins a 8.000 caràcters, mentre que nvarchar ajuda fins a 4.000 caràcters.


Què és Varchar?

Varchar és un tipus d'informació del servidor AQL relatiu als caràcters variables. Els caràcters que no són Unicode es guarden mitjançant varchar. L'assignació de memòria a varchar s'ajusta als caràcters inserits. En definició de temes, varchar ajuda fins a 8.000 caràcters.

Què és Nvarchar?

Nvarchar és un tipus d'informació de SQL Server pertanyent als caràcters de variables. Els caràcters Unicode es guarden mitjançant nvarchar. És probable que es desin diversos idiomes a la base d'informació. Si s’utilitzen altres idiomes, nvarchar ocuparà el doble d’espai per emmagatzemar un conjunt extens de caràcters. En definició arxivada, nvarchar ajuda fins a 4.000 caràcters.

Diferències claus

  1. Narchar s'utilitza per emmagatzemar caràcters Unicode, mentre que varchar no comercialitza caràcters Unicode.
  2. Varchar s'utilitza per emmagatzemar caràcters que no siguin Unicode, mentre que nvarchar no comercialitza caràcters que no siguin Unicode.
  3. L'emmagatzematge de dades 1 byte per caràcter a varchar mentre que a narchar info emmagatzematge no és simplement 1 byte per caràcter.
  4. L’emmagatzematge de dades a nvarchar és de 2 bytes per caràcter mentre que a l’informació de varchar l’emmagatzematge no és simplement de 2 bytes per caràcter.
  5. En definició de temes, varchar ajuda fins a 8.000 caràcters, mentre que nvarchar ajuda fins a 4.000 caràcters.
  6. L’assignació de memòria en varchar és similar al nombre d’inserits inserits, més dos bytes addicionals per offset, mentre que a l’assignació de memòria nvarchar és similar al doble del nombre inserit de caràcters més amb bytes addicionals per a offset.
  7. Si també es podria desar caràcters Unicode a la columna o a la variable, s'utilitza varchar, mentre que per l'altre aspecte, si no es desa Unicode a columna o variable, s'utilitza nvarchar.
  8. A la declaració de variable o definició de columna, si simplement no s’especifica la vàlvula n del paràmetre no obligatori, es creu que serà 1 per a varchar i 2 per a nvarchar.

El que cal é que l'Etat e peni generalment com a reultat de l'autoritat del Govern, mentre que el territori e diuen com a reultat de le àree que no ho exigeixen el Govern. També...

Tot i que ambdue infeccion ón cauade per microbi. La principal diferència entre una infecció bacteriana i vírica é que el bacteri ón un organime unicel·lular que t&#...

Missatges Interessants